Abstract: The current study in the rural area of Kutai Kertanegrara, East Kalimantan, Indonesia showed still high risk of Strongylodes stercoralis infection. The condition due to potential reinfected by filarial Strongylodes stercoralis in the environment from filarial contaminants surrounding households were closed with field rice and surrounding rubber and palm plantation. And then treatment strategy for reducing the filarial of Strongylodes stercoralis is very important by using clay Kutai. The high clay content in the soil in Kutai (59%) is potential for filaria Strongylodes stercoralis reduction.The purpose of this study saw the filarial larva of Strongylodes stercoralis reduction by clay Kutai with basic of study related concentration, duration of contact, and survival of the larva. The diagnosis that was used for the founding of Strongylodes stercoralis was the Kato Katz technique dan Agar Plate Culture/APC on 118 samples from the community surrounding palm and rubber plantations. In the experimental study 7 formula of clay Kutai which had used in the laboratory study. The result showed hookworm infection found in Sebuntal Village was 14(11,9%) . The experiment showed that clay Kutai has high effectiveness for inactivation of the filaria larva of Strongylodes stercoralis infection. The Clay formula with 10 mg(100%) could be killed the filaria larva of Strongylodes stercoralism < 1 minute reaction. Using clay Kutai has high effectiveness for inactivation of filaria larvae Strongylodes stercoralis infection that could be improved in practice wastewater treatment and the granulate of clay Kutai should be used to spread on wet soil that is contaminated with filaria larvae.
